Check engine light

i'm taking my car in because my service light came on. the idiot at jiffy lube started putting in castrol instead of mobil one. i noticed it and yelled at the top of my lungs. he drained the castrol and then filled up with mobil one. that was two days before the check engine light came on. could this be the reason for the service light?

Go to autozone (or some place like that) and get them to pull the code. All they have to do is hook up to the factory port (under stearing wheel) and pull the code. Then you'll know if it's oil related.

My first guess would be no, this wouldn't cause a CEL. But you really never know what might have happened unless you have the code.

Even if you didnt catch the mistake it wouldnt have hurt the car. Synthetic oils are compatable with each other. Also synthetic & non-synthetic oils are compatable. Even if the guy were to put in regular oil you would be okay. A lot of Evo owners will actually drain out the Mobil One when they first buy the car and put in non-synthetic oil. The idea is to use reg. oil during the break-in period because synthetic is too slippery for the piston rings to properly seat with the cylinder walls. (I dont agree with this on the Evo)
